Market Wire - Fall has just begun, but according to turfgrass experts from across the nation, lawn owners should waste no time in preparing their lawns for the winter weather ahead. Fall lawn care promotes good root development, enhances storage of energy reserves and extends color retention in lawns. Grass Seed USA, a national coalition of grass seed farmers and academic turf specialists, conducted a survey of university professors and turfgrass specialists from esteemed horticulture departments to gather lesser known fall lawn care tips for a healthy, beautiful lawn come spring.
